Well I tried to use the Pocketmac to sync, its not so stable, sometimes can, n cannot, nowadays I just use google sync to sync my ical+addressbook,
So basiclly from Mac to gmail to blackberry, it works much better that pocketmac..... Be warn its not prefect..but it works
